Date: Monday, April 17, 2023 @ 19:52:35
  Author: dvzrv
Revision: 1447062

archrelease: copy trunk to community-x86_64

Added:
  netavark/repos/community-x86_64/PKGBUILD
    (from rev 1447061, netavark/trunk/PKGBUILD)
Deleted:
  netavark/repos/community-x86_64/PKGBUILD

----------+
 PKGBUILD |  109 ++++++++++++++++++++++++++++++++-----------------------------
 1 file changed, 58 insertions(+), 51 deletions(-)

Deleted: PKGBUILD
===================================================================
--- PKGBUILD    2023-04-17 19:52:19 UTC (rev 1447061)
+++ PKGBUILD    2023-04-17 19:52:35 UTC (rev 1447062)
@@ -1,51 +0,0 @@
-# Maintainer: David Runge <[email protected]>
-# Maintainer: Morten Linderud <[email protected]>
-
-pkgname=netavark
-_commit=0b5ab2e8648c801ff55a745ea0e32b7b9ab7ccb4  # refs/tags/v1.5.0
-pkgver=1.5.0
-pkgrel=1
-pkgdesc="Container network stack"
-arch=(x86_64)
-url="https://github.com/containers/netavark";
-license=(Apache)
-depends=(gcc-libs glibc)
-makedepends=(cargo git libgit2 mandown protobuf)
-optdepends=('aardvark-dns: for authorative DNS server')
-provides=(container-network-stack=2)
-source=(git+https://github.com/containers/netavark.git#tag=$_commit)
-sha256sums=('SKIP')
-# NOTE: pinning commit until upstream clarifies commitment to chain of trust:
-# https://github.com/containers/netavark/issues/231
-# validpgpkeys=('74FE091D25519980B2D84447160386BECB6F0643')  # Brent Baude 
<[email protected]>
-
-prepare() {
-  cd $pkgname
-  # fix issue with yanked dependency: 
https://github.com/containers/netavark/issues/521
-  git cherry-pick -n 3a1ff2447d8cef1eeab0413bbbbb1f1fb8280a17
-  cargo fetch --locked --target "$CARCH-unknown-linux-gnu"
-}
-
-build() {
-  export RUSTUP_TOOLCHAIN=stable
-  export CARGO_TARGET_DIR=target
-
-  cd $pkgname
-  # generate man page directly as docs target is broken: 
https://github.com/containers/netavark/issues/524
-  mandown docs/$pkgname.1.md > $pkgname.1
-  cargo build --frozen --release --all-features
-}
-
-check() {
-  export RUSTUP_TOOLCHAIN=stable
-
-  cd $pkgname
-  cargo test --frozen --all-features
-}
-
-package() {
-  cd $pkgname
-  install -vDm 755 target/release/$pkgname -t "$pkgdir/usr/lib/podman/"
-  install -vDm 644 $pkgname.1 -t "$pkgdir/usr/share/man/man1/"
-  install -vDm 644 README.md -t "$pkgdir/usr/share/doc/$pkgname/"
-}

Copied: netavark/repos/community-x86_64/PKGBUILD (from rev 1447061, 
netavark/trunk/PKGBUILD)
===================================================================
--- PKGBUILD                            (rev 0)
+++ PKGBUILD    2023-04-17 19:52:35 UTC (rev 1447062)
@@ -0,0 +1,58 @@
+# Maintainer: David Runge <[email protected]>
+# Maintainer: Morten Linderud <[email protected]>
+
+pkgname=netavark
+_commit=f6a0729c69997a2e36a0a62be1341f1107d6e8e8  # refs/tags/v1.6.0
+pkgver=1.6.0
+pkgrel=1
+pkgdesc="Container network stack"
+arch=(x86_64)
+url="https://github.com/containers/netavark";
+license=(Apache)
+depends=(
+  gcc-libs
+  glibc
+)
+makedepends=(
+  cargo
+  git
+  libgit2
+  mandown
+  protobuf
+)
+optdepends=('aardvark-dns: for authorative DNS server')
+provides=(container-network-stack=2)
+source=(git+https://github.com/containers/netavark.git#tag=$_commit)
+sha256sums=('SKIP')
+# NOTE: pinning commit until upstream clarifies commitment to chain of trust:
+# https://github.com/containers/netavark/issues/231
+# validpgpkeys=('74FE091D25519980B2D84447160386BECB6F0643')  # Brent Baude 
<[email protected]>
+
+prepare() {
+  cd $pkgname
+  cargo fetch --locked --target "$CARCH-unknown-linux-gnu"
+}
+
+build() {
+  export RUSTUP_TOOLCHAIN=stable
+  export CARGO_TARGET_DIR=target
+
+  cd $pkgname
+  # generate man page directly as docs target is broken: 
https://github.com/containers/netavark/issues/524
+  mandown docs/$pkgname.1.md > $pkgname.1
+  cargo build --frozen --release --all-features
+}
+
+check() {
+  export RUSTUP_TOOLCHAIN=stable
+
+  cd $pkgname
+  cargo test --frozen --all-features
+}
+
+package() {
+  cd $pkgname
+  install -vDm 755 target/release/$pkgname -t "$pkgdir/usr/lib/podman/"
+  install -vDm 644 $pkgname.1 -t "$pkgdir/usr/share/man/man1/"
+  install -vDm 644 README.md -t "$pkgdir/usr/share/doc/$pkgname/"
+}

Reply via email to